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Ashford International to Fishguard & Goodwick start from as little as £34.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Ashford International to Fishguard & Goodwick start from £127.30 one way, or £128.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Ashford International to Fishguard & Goodwick are available for £184.50 one way, or £369.00 return

Modern Facilities and Amenities

Stepping into Ashford International, travelers are greeted with modern, accessible facilities designed to make the journey as seamless as possible. The station offers extensive ticketing options, including a ticket office open from the early hours of 5:30 am until 9:30 pm, Monday through Saturday, and a slightly later start at 6:00 am on Sundays. Ticket machines are widely available for self-service, with provisions for accessibility.

For those needing special assistance, Ashford International offers comprehensive support, including an induction loop, customer help points, and step-free access across the entire station. Waiting rooms and shelters provide comfort, with heated facilities on select platforms, while seating areas cater to travelers needing a respite between connections.

Facilities and Amenities

While Fishguard & Goodwick may not have a ticket office, worry not, because there are ticket machines available for your convenience. These machines are equipped with touchscreen technology but remember to bring your debit or credit card as they are cashless. If you’ve purchased your tickets online, collection is a breeze via these machines. Accessibility is a key feature here, with step-free access throughout the station.

However, if you're used to modern conveniences like Wi-Fi and refreshment facilities, you'll need to plan ahead since these are not available at the station. Also, there are no staff present, but you can reach out to their dedicated helpline for assistance. For cyclists, there are 12 bicycle parking spaces available onsite, sheltered but without CCTV monitoring.
